MS IAS Academy Announces Results of 10th Batch Entrance Exam
Final Selection List Released for Free UPSC Civil Services Coaching Programme
MS IAS Academy has announced the final results of the All India Entrance Examination conducted for admission to the 10th Batch of its Free UPSC Civil Services Coaching Programme.
The final list of selected candidates was released following the successful completion of the written entrance examination and subsequent interview process. The written examination was conducted at more than 100 centres across the country, followed by interviews held in Delhi and Hyderabad.
Selected Candidates to Report Between September 1 and 3
Announcing the selection process, Mr. Anwar Ahmed, Managing Director of MS Education Academy, said that all selected candidates are being informed about their selection through phone calls, emails and text messages. He directed the selected candidates to report to the MS IAS Academy campus in Hyderabad between September 1 and 3, 2026.
Candidates are required to report within the stipulated period to secure their admission. Those who fail to report within the given timeframe will miss their admission opportunity, and their seats will subsequently be offered to candidates on the waiting list.

Completely Free Residential Coaching
The MS IAS Academy’s UPSC Civil Services Coaching Programme is offered completely free of cost to selected candidates.
As part of the programme, students are required to stay at the academy’s residential campus continuously until the UPSC Civil Services Preliminary Examination scheduled for May 2027.
The residential model is designed to provide students with an intensive learning environment, along with comprehensive coaching, academic guidance, mentorship and continuous preparation support.
